About this book

This book presents various methodologies for determining the ecological footprint, carbon footprint, water footprint, nitrogen footprint, and life cycle environment impacts and illustrates these methodologies through various applications. In particular, it systematically and comprehensively introduces the concepts and tools of the ‘footprint family’ and discusses their applications in energy and industrial systems.  

The book begins by providing an overview of the effects of the economic growth dynamics on ecological footprint and then presents the definitions, concepts, calculation methods, and applications of the various footprints. The unique characteristic of this book is that it demonstrates the applications of various footprints in different systems including economic system, ecological system, beef production system, cropping system, building, food chain, sugarcane bioproducts, and the Belt and Road Initiative.  

Providing both background theory and practical advice, the book is of interest to energy and environmental researchers, graduate students, and engineers.

About the editor

Dr. Jingzheng Ren is currently an assistant professor at The Hong Kong Polytechnic University. He is also an adjunct associate professor at the University of Southern Denmark and the associated senior research fellow of the Institute for Security & Development Policy. He worked as an associate professor at the University of Southern Denmark before moving to The Hong Kong Polytechnic University. He has published more than 200 publications including 160 journal papers, 1 authored book, more than 10 books, and more than 40 book chapters.
